Frequently Asked Questions about Saint Sauveur

How much are Studio apartments in Saint Sauveur?

There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in Saint Sauveur with rent ranges from $930 to $1,250 with an average price of $1,036.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Saint Sauveur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Saint Sauveur ranges from $1,175 to $1,365 with an average monthly rent of $1,223.
